Description

This is a footbridge located on Waterend Road in Cupar, built around 1900. It features a single span with a gentle segmental arch made of iron. The bridge has decorative ironwork parapets with slender balusters, and barleytwist posts that divide the sections. There are three pairs of scrollwork braces and knob-finished barleytwist posts framing the entrances. A gate is present at the northern end, and the deck is made of boarded timber.
